Output fbffa7247323dba0a28a5d0b78c2e2ff89f30bb94e8c71e7826dc9e2fade9de8:1

value
28424
script pubkey
OP_0 OP_PUSHBYTES_20 eb1c19c44a42e8714c641566d56bd10daf772fda
address
bc1qavwpn3z2gt58znryz4nd2673pkhhwt76r05fsq
transaction
fbffa7247323dba0a28a5d0b78c2e2ff89f30bb94e8c71e7826dc9e2fade9de8
confirmations
106688
spent
true